Потому что нужно передавать весь массив свойств. Если нужно 1 свойство обновить используется отдельный метод
https://dev.1c-bitrix.ru/api_help/iblock/classes/ciblockelement/setpropertyvaluesex.php
Покажите дамп ДО
Ща, 10 мин
Я разобрался Из-за изменения статуса документа БП срабатывало событие Update, а у меня на Add и Update одна функция была, а проверки на существование ключа PROPERTY_VALUES не было, из-за этого все затиралось
В последнее время даже checkFields делаю разные для add/update.
Ну, не только статуса, добавление согласующих и всякое такое, каждое это действие вызывает Update из-за того что в свойства элемента ИБ записывается
Возьму на вооружение, спасибо)
Обсуждают сегодня